That's my favorite way to do it, too. Only one opamp required, and
high input impedance, low output impedance at the same time.
I often use pots with center stop. To achieve exactly zero gain
at the center stop, I usually solder a trimpot parallel to the normal
ptentiometer, with approx. 10 times its value.
The trimpot also prevents lock-up in case of intermittent
work of the main pot.
Good values are 100k for resistors and pot, and 1M for the optional
trimpot.
